Doctor Waffle welcomes her first guest writer, Melissa Cole, who reads an essay about a long-ago essay she wrote for Newsweek and the fallout that ensued. Our conversation ranges over topics like female bodily autonomy, the right to privacy, the public personas of writers, and those SRA boxes in the back of your middle-school classroom — shout-out to all the Gen Xers who know exactly what I’m talking about.
